Austin

The best option for this location is to have a car for transportation purposes – either your own or one from Hertz Rental car. However, the Austin Research Laboratory is also accessible from most public transportation as well as by car pooling.

Car Pooling

Another alternative is to share a ride with one of your peers who has a car. Try connecting with people in your department or other summer students who can offer a ride or who need a ride.


Hertz Rental

You will be able to rent a car (compact-size) from Hertz at the IBM rates. If you share the vehicle with two to three others you can defray your transportation costs, and still have flexibility.

Hertz Rental Option Q & A:
Q:
What if I choose to rent a vehicle other than compact-size?
A:
Students can choose to rent any sized vehicle from Hertz. Remember, rates will vary.
Q:
When do I get the IBM Rate?
A:
The IBM rate will be applied when the student receives their IBM Badge, on their start date, and rents the vehicle at the Hertz Office.
Q: What if I need a car at the airport? Can I rent a car from Hertz there?
A:
If you need transportation at the airport, you can obtain the IBM rate for the car, provided you show the Hertz representative a copy of your offer letter from IBM.
